引言
在数字化时代,拥有一个个人网站不仅可以展示个人作品、简历和兴趣爱好,还能提升个人的专业形象。而使用GitHub搭建个人网站是一种高效且免费的方法。本文将详细介绍如何在GitHub上搭建一个静态主题的个人网站,帮助您快速入门。
什么是静态网站?
静态网站是指所有网页的内容在服务器上是固定的,用户访问时直接加载这些文件,而不需要服务器实时生成页面。静态网站的优点包括:
- 加载速度快:由于文件是预先生成的,加载时间显著降低。
- 安全性高:不需要动态生成页面,减少了被攻击的风险。
- 成本低廉:使用GitHub Pages完全免费。
GitHub简介
GitHub是一个基于Git的代码托管平台,它支持版本控制、项目管理和协作开发。在GitHub上,用户可以方便地管理代码,同时GitHub Pages提供了免费托管静态网页的服务,非常适合用来搭建个人网站。
如何在GitHub上搭建个人网站
搭建个人网站的步骤如下:
1. 创建GitHub账号
- 访问 GitHub官方网站。
- 点击“Sign up”注册一个新账号,填写相关信息,验证邮箱。
2. 创建新仓库
- 登录GitHub,点击右上角的“+”号,选择“New repository”。
- 输入仓库名称,格式为
<用户名>.github.io
(例如:yourusername.github.io
),选择公开仓库。 - 点击“Create repository”按钮。
3. 选择静态主题
在GitHub上,有许多现成的静态主题可供选择。你可以在GitHub Pages主题上找到许多优秀的主题。
- 选择你喜欢的主题并查看其文档,了解如何使用。
4. 上传静态文件
- 下载选择的主题文件,解压缩后将文件上传到刚创建的仓库。
- 你可以通过“Upload files”按钮来上传文件,或者使用Git命令行工具。
5. 配置GitHub Pages
- 在仓库主页,点击“Settings”。
- 找到“Pages”选项卡,选择“Source”,然后选择“main branch”作为源。
- 点击“Save”,你的网站将开始生成,通常需要几分钟的时间。
6. 自定义网站内容
- 根据你的需求修改HTML、CSS文件以适应你的个人风格。
- 你可以添加个人简历、项目展示、博客等内容。
7. 访问你的网站
- 完成以上步骤后,你可以通过
https://<用户名>.github.io
访问你的网站。 - 此外,可以使用自定义域名,使网站更具专业性。
常见静态网站生成器
- Jekyll:GitHub Pages支持的静态网站生成器,使用Markdown语言,适合创建博客。
- Hugo:快速且灵活的静态网站生成器,适合大型网站。
- Gatsby:基于React的静态网站生成器,适合开发者使用。
网站优化技巧
- 使用CDN:使用内容分发网络加速网站加载速度。
- SEO优化:合理使用关键词,优化网页标题和描述,增加搜索引擎可见性。
- 响应式设计:确保网站在不同设备上都能正常显示。
FAQ
1. GitHub Pages是免费的吗?
是的,GitHub Pages提供免费托管静态网页的服务,只要你有一个GitHub账号即可。
2. 我可以使用自定义域名吗?
可以。你可以将自己的域名指向你的GitHub Pages网站,GitHub提供详细的指引。
3. 静态网站的更新难吗?
不难。只需在本地编辑文件并上传到GitHub仓库,网站会自动更新。
4. 如何确保我的网站安全?
使用HTTPS和确保代码和插件的安全性,定期更新和监控网站内容。
5. 如果我想增加互动功能,该如何实现?
你可以集成第三方服务,如评论系统、联系表单等,来实现互动功能。
结论
搭建个人网站的过程并不复杂,尤其是在GitHub上。通过选择合适的静态主题、合理配置GitHub Pages以及不断优化网站内容,您可以轻松创建一个展示个人风采的网页。希望本文能对您有所帮助!
正文完